Non-UK trusts will also be required to register if they have UK … WebRegistering the death is done by the Registrar of Births, Deaths and Marriages, which is situated at the local register office. If someone dies at home, the death should be registered at the register office in the district where they lived. If the death took place in hospital, nursing home or other public building, the death must be registered ... We are a top … come and see whatWebWhile the exact process will depend on the location and nature of the death, registration normally needs to occur within 5 days of the death in England, Wales and N. Ireland and within 8 days of the death in Scotland.
